The fuel system is not vacuum assisted gravity feed. It is only gravity feed.
The vacuum is nothing more than a switch that turns the petcock on and does nothing to increase rate of fuel flow.

Is it an auto type or Motorcycle filter?? Sometimes auto type filter will not flow without pressure. Had a tank of Gas in my GS 850 wanted to drain and filter it into another container. With the hose disconnected and on prime 5/16 plastic auto filter would not flow more than a few drops
